

Founded by Jean-Marie Corre in Levallois-Perret, near Paris. Initially, the company was simply called Corre, but after a series of racing victories by pilot Waldemar Lestienne, whose family crest featured a unicorn, the brand was renamed Corre La Licorne – “Corre the Unicorn”. After World War II, the company failed to recover and ceased production in 1947, and was officially closed in 1949.
